[Bug 154049] Re: Nvidia driver not working with dual screen

2008-10-05 Thread alex_g
In my case the bug is located in nvidia-glx-177.
I use a Sony 46 inch TV to watch movies in dual view.
After log-in into Ubuntu the right resolution is shown on the TV screen for 
just a second.
Then, the background image becomes smaller but I can still move the move across 
the whole screen.
But trying to start a movie player (smplayer and vlc tested) leeds to a crash 
of some gnome applications.
So I cant play movies on the laptop (vostro 1500 with Geforce 8400) or on the 
tv.

I tried using the 173 driver which resulted in a complete crash of the display, 
which I had to repair.
Getting back to 177 was quite hard, I had to remove the driver firstr and then 
use the console to instal it again

For me this bug is quite critical as I can't watch my movies any more
